What to do After a Recent Accident

What to do after a recent accidentThere are several things people generally do after being involved in a motor vehicle crash. These include:

  1. Call 911: Drivers typically call 911 following a crash. The police officer that arrives at the scene of an accident will often draft an official police report about the details of the crash. This report will include information that may help a future claim.
  2. Seek medical care: If you are injured or suspect you may have been injured following a motor vehicle accident consider seeking medical attention as soon as possible. The extent of accident-related injuries may not appear right away and could worsen over time. Medical treatment can help rule out less apparent injuries and create an official record of medical care and symptoms.
  3. Collect information and evidence: After an accident, it is important to document contact information such as names, phone numbers, and addresses of drivers, occupants, and witnesses involved after an accident. Photographs of the scene can serve as evidence later on.

What is the Statute of Limitations for Personal Injury in Buffalo?

A statute of limitations is a law that sets a time limitation for bringing certain kinds of legal action, such as a lawsuit.

The statute of limitations for a Buffalo personal injury lawsuit depends on numerous factors and may be different in every situation. For some personal injury lawsuits, the statute of limitations is three years from the date of the accident. However, if an injury victim is under the age of 18, this statute of limitations could possibly be delayed. In fatal motor vehicle crashes, a representative of the deceased may choose to pursue a wrongful death lawsuit. In this case, the statute of limitations is approximately two years from the date of death.

Every injury case is unique, however, and several potential statutes of limitations could apply to your case. You should not rely on the information above to determine the statutes of limitations that apply to your case.  You should instead speak with a personal injury attorney who can examine your case closely.
